Arapahoe, Wyoming - Other Languages

Although finding a drug rehab facility can seem like a difficult task, finding one that provides services for other languages is an added challenge. However, today many rehab facilities employ staff members who are bilingual. When you have found a rehab program that meets your needs, speak to their staff about the likelihood of providing their services other languages during treatment. Even though they may not initially have the capability to provide their services in other languages they may be able to find a way to accommodate your needs. Often the rehab program will do its best to rise to the occasion and see what is available to help their clients.
